Get SAS and IBM certified.Business analytics is divided into three primary categories: descriptive, predictive, and prescriptive. Descriptive analytics uses historical data to answer the questions “what happened” or “what is happening.”. Predictive analytics uses historical data to try to predict future outcomes. Prescriptive analytics combines the other two.

Perhaps what we currently deem the future of business analytics will one day soon be as obsolete as tracking sales with sticks and stones, ...Aug 15, 2022 · What is a business analytics degree? A business analytics degree prepares students to work with businesses in collecting data and interpreting it to improve operations and staffing. Business analytics degree students learn a variety of skills that benefit a business, including problem-solving, analytical, communication, and project management ... Data analytics is a subdiscipline of data science, focusing on the practical application of data. Data analysts can model scenarios and predict trends but typically lack business training. Business analytics combines business and data analytics. A business analyst excels at modeling and forecasting and must also interact with clientele and ...3. QS ...Cornell’s MSBA program curriculum includes online and residential coursework. Students complete 11 online core MSBA courses and six online electives, choosing from concentrations in finance analytics, marketing analytics, operations and supply chain analytics, and business analytics. In this case, you can add a user to ... zales engraved necklace Business analytics and data science differ in their applications of data. Business analytics focuses on analyzing statistical patterns to inform key business decisions. Professionals in this field analyze historical data to make recommendations to company leaders, managers and other stakeholders about the future of a company.
